§490:3-113 Date of instrument. (a) An instrument may be antedated or postdated. The date stated determines the time of payment if the instrument is payable at a fixed period after date. Except as provided in section 490:4-401(c), an instrument payable on demand is not payable bef…
HRS §490:3-114 Contradictory terms of instrument
0.2K chars
§490:3-114 Contradictory terms of instrument. If an instrument contains contradictory terms, typewritten terms prevail over printed terms, handwritten terms prevail over both, and words prevail over numbers. [L 1991, c 118, pt of §1]
